This review is on the Walnut Room Sunday Brunch on Easter Sunday, March 23, 2008. The staff and service was excellent. Very friendly staff and there's not beating the elegance of the Hotel President Building. That being said, the food was just OK. The food was not all hot, as it should have been, and there were no linen tablecloths, which I expected to have in such a beautiful building. The price of the brunch was $39.95, which is way over-priced for what it was. There were a lot of vacant tables, so that should be a telling sign to management (and potential diners)that something was not up to par. Almost everywhere that serves a decent brunch on Easter Sunday in Kansas City is packed and reserved way ahead of time. I definitely would not go back for this brunch at the price they charged.
